bekolinux
Yeni Üye
- Katılım
- 16 Ocak 2022
- Mesajlar
- 4
- En iyi yanıt
- 0
- Puanları
- 1
- Yaş
- 35
- Konum
- istanbul
- Ad Soyad
- mahmut kamer
- Office Vers.
- office 2019
merhaba herkese
d sütununda d2 den d10000 hücreleri dahil karışık değerde rakamlarım var. ben bu rakamlardan 30 ve üzeri olan değerlerin silinmesini istiyorum.
ortalama almak için bu bana gerekli. fakat bu değerlerde 29.99 gibi küsüratlı degerlerde var. küsüratlı değerlerde şöyle bir sorun oldu. 29.93 diye değerim var aşağıdaki kodlarda bunu 29.5 ve üzeri olduğu için 30 olarak yuvarlıyor ve siliyor. bana sadece 30.00 ve üzerini silecek kod lazım. çok denedim yapamadım
yardım için herkese şimdiden teşekkur ederim
d sütununda d2 den d10000 hücreleri dahil karışık değerde rakamlarım var. ben bu rakamlardan 30 ve üzeri olan değerlerin silinmesini istiyorum.
ortalama almak için bu bana gerekli. fakat bu değerlerde 29.99 gibi küsüratlı degerlerde var. küsüratlı değerlerde şöyle bir sorun oldu. 29.93 diye değerim var aşağıdaki kodlarda bunu 29.5 ve üzeri olduğu için 30 olarak yuvarlıyor ve siliyor. bana sadece 30.00 ve üzerini silecek kod lazım. çok denedim yapamadım
yardım için herkese şimdiden teşekkur ederim
Dim sayi As Long
For i = 2 To 10000
If IsNumeric(Cells(i, "D").Value) = True Then
sayi = Cells(i, "D")
If sayi > 29 Then
Cells(i, "D").ClearContents
End If
End If
Next i